One of the most successful coaches in the last decade in Liga MX has been Anthony Mohammedwho recently confessed that after his departure from Atletico Mineiro in Brazil has received some offers from Mexico, but has rejected them.

Without saying the names of which teams they have been, the “Turkish” limited himself to pointing out that none of the projects convinced himso for now it’s fine like that.

I would like to have a challenge to be champion. I just finished working (at Atlético Mineiro) and I had many job offers, but I don’t feel like working and none of them moved me,” he said in an interview for ESPN.

It does not close the doors to Mexico

Likewise, the 52-year-old strategist declared that he has many close ties with Mexico, since his children were born there and most of it as a soccer player and DT developed it in Aztec territory, so if there were any serious possibility, he would be analyzing it for able to return.

“I couldn’t say: ‘this is a project that I like.’ I am 52 years old and half of my life I lived there, my children are all Mexican, it is the place where I feel most comfortable“, he added.

Mohamed made his coaching debut in 2003 with the Zacatepec in the Second Division and, since then, he has been in several clubs, among them the Xolos from Tijuana, America and Rayadoswith whom he was champion in the Apertura 2012, 2014 and 2019, respectively.

His most recent adventure in Mexico happened with Monterrey in the Opening 2020 and his last job was with the Mineiro del Brazilian.
